Responsibilities

  • Load and unload baggage and co-mail of various weight and dimensions to and from aircraft and applicable airport baggage areas
  • Operate ground service equipment
  • Marshal aircraft to and from gates
  • Provide proper handling of baggage requiring special care
  • Service aircraft lavatories
  • Responsible for aircraft security searches and commissary security searches as required
  • Ensure ramp areas are safe and free of Foreign Objects Debris (FOD) and that all ground service equipment is properly maintained
  • Follow safety regulations, which include the proper use of ground service equipment and wearing proper safety items

About Allegiant Air

Allegiant Air operates a low-cost airline that connects travelers from smaller cities to popular leisure destinations. The airline uses an all-jet fleet and offers low fares, making air travel affordable. In addition to flights, Allegiant provides travel-related products like hotel rooms, rental cars, and entertainment tickets, which can be purchased through its website. Since starting in 1999 with just one aircraft, Allegiant has grown to operate over 350 routes across the United States with a fleet of more than 92 aircraft. The company focuses on providing value and convenience for leisure travelers, offering both individual flight tickets and bundled vacation packages that include various travel services.
